According to the 1941 census, united Punjab had a population of 28.4 millions, including 16.2 millions Muslims, 7.5 millions Hindus and 3.7 millions Sikhs and the rest were Christians.

The Punjab Police Friday detained a woman from Haryana, a day after her five-year-old girl was found dead near the Golden Temple. The footage from CCTVs installed outside Golden Temple showed the woman, identified as Maninder Kaur, a resident of Yamunanagar in Haryana, carrying the child in her lap, police said.
